Canyamel Golf, Majorca


By Michel Monnard

What we like at Canyamel Golf, is the consistently good quality of the course during the whole year. In the last few years, the owners have improved the clubhouse massively, the added lots of trees (not that golfers really need them, as they tend to make our matters more difficult), and just next to the golf course, the brand new Hyatt Park Hotel will be opening in 2016. This will probably be the landmark of hotel quality on the whole island.

The first six holes are never even, always either upwards or downwards. The holes are quite interesting to play, as their are many surprises. The greens are surprisingly difficult, due to speed and trickiness. What makes them nice to play is that the greens are soft, so the balls tend to hold on the green. Should you hit the wrong spot on the green, three-putting is a good achievement.

The last nine holes are pretty straight forward. Lots of new trees have been added. When we came to the island, 20 years ago, there where not half of the trees. The bunkers are awesome quality throughout. The sand is bigger in size, that drains water very easily. If you know how to use the bounce of your sand wedge, getting out of them should not be a problem. Getting the ball close, is an entirely different story – depending on the flag position.

The clubhouse is brand new, all in white, lots of quality and style. Food is great in quality and presentation.

An in all, there is an awesome day of golf up for you at Canyamel Golf.
